Vowels are essential building blocks of language, and understanding them is crucial for children aged 5-9 as they develop early literacy skills. At this age, children are beginning to decode words, sound out letters, and read independently. Vowels—A, E, I, O, U, and sometimes Y—play a pivotal role in this process, as they create the nucleus of syllables and determine the pronunciation of words.
Focusing on vowels helps children enhance their reading fluency and comprehension. When students understand how different vowels affect word sounds, they become more proficient in sounding out unfamiliar words, ultimately boosting their confidence. Additionally, a solid grasp of vowels lays the foundation for spelling and writing. By recognizing short and long vowel sounds, children can expand their vocabulary and express themselves more creatively.
